Museological exhibition “Transformations: the Amazon and the anthropocene” Knowledge objects and their relationship with science teaching. Rev. Exitus [online]. 2020, vol.10, e020096.  Epub Mar 28, 2022. ISSN 2237-9460.  https://doi.org/10.24065/2237-9460.2020v10n1id1232.

Human activities have severely impacted the planetary system, so that humanity has been considered a geological force. It is in this context that scientists have proposed the establishment of a new epoch - the Anthropocene. The Anthropocene is part of the great discussions regarding environmental and social aspects, which bring multiple risks to humanity and the environment. Its approach should not be restricted to the formal classroom space. In this sense, the museum exhibition “Transformations: the Amazon and the Anthropocene”, of the Museu Paraense Emilio Goeldi, in the municipality of Belém, state of Pará, brought together these two important themes in contemporary times. To contribute to this discussion, we undertook an investigation process, aiming to apprehend how the objects of knowledge of the Exhibition are presented, in their relationship with science teaching. We adopted the qualitative approach and resorted to free observation, which is a data collection technique; such data were submitted to interpretative analysis. Many of the objects of knowledge linked to the Anthropocene in the Amazon were highlighted in the Exhibition, namely: deforestation, fires, monoculture, cattle ranching, among others, linked to the forest. We understand that the Exhibition played an important role in the educational field, as it brought objects of knowledge which represent mediators of teaching and learning with meaning to think about the events that contribute to the Anthropocene in the Amazon.
